When you get a quote for exterior painting, the total depends on a few practical things. The size and height of your home are the biggest factors—a multi-story house takes more time and safety equipment. The current condition of your siding also matters; if there is significant peeling, wood rot, or mold, that area needs extra prep work before a brush ever touches it. Summer offers the best conditions for drying, but extreme heat can be an issue. If it’s too hot, paint might dry too quickly, which keeps it from bonding to the surface. We often schedule painting for earlier in the day to avoid the peak afternoon sun and keep the finish looking smooth.

For Charlotte exteriors, we recommend high-quality acrylic latex paints designed for durability and resistance to humidity and sun. These paints offer excellent color retention and protection against the local climate. The pros can advise on specific brands and finishes suited for your home's siding.
